Chemical leak sees college evacuated

-

A college was evacuated after an unknown chemical odour was reported.

Two fire engines and an ambulance crew were stationed outside Ashford College on Elwick Road from about 1.30pm on Tuesday.

Victoria Copp-Crawley, college principal, said: “Fumes with smoke within one of the art and design studios at the College triggered our sensors. Kent Fire and Rescue Service was alerted and students and staff all safely evacuated from the site. The fumes and smoke have now been cleared from the building.”

The college has since reopened.

Kent Fire and Rescue Service said: “We responded to an incident following reports of an unknown chemical smell. Two fire engines and a hazardous material officer were sent to the scene.”
